## 3.2.0 — BounceBeacon

Heads up for review: we renamed the old `BB_SMTP_PASS` setting because the bounce processor no longer talks SMTP directly — it pulls bounce events from the Relaywick queue instead. The legacy name is now ignored (with a startup warning, so misconfigs are loud). Nothing else about scoping changed; same rotation policy, same vault path. Configs must be updated by hand. In each environment file, replace the old entry with:

secret setting of tawif-tajop: COURIER_KEY13=819c65d82d2bd

During the Greywing 2.4 incident, plugin authors regenerated the Lintfall baseline locally and masked 300+ real findings. Going forward, the baseline ships with the SDK and is read-only; plugins that need suppressions must use inline annotations, which are budgeted per module. CI rejects any diff touching the baseline without a signed waiver. Plugin authors should size their suppression budgets against the limits we enforce at merge time, which are defined in the config as shown here.

limits module of kahag-fajop:
QUOTAS = {
    "wenwyn": 10,
    "zorath": 1,
}

## Formula sandbox tuning

User-supplied formulas in Gridmoor execute inside a restricted interpreter with hard ceilings on time, memory, and call depth. Reviewers should confirm any change to these ceilings is justified in the PR description, since raising them widens the abuse surface. Defaults were chosen from production traces. The current limits are as follows.

limits module of tafog-fawip:
WEIGHTS = {
    "julix": 57,
    "lamys": 992,
    "kasvan": 209,
    "quenok": 750,
    "alddor": 259,
    "oliath": 1009,
    "wenix": 815,
}

# Dedupler environments

Three environments: dev, staging, prod. Dev dedupes nothing — every alert passes through, by design. Staging mirrors prod traffic at 10% and shares the prod suppression rules. Prod is the only environment paged against. Support should never test suppression rules in prod; use staging. Environment promotion happens Tuesdays via the Oakmere pipeline. Config differs per environment only in window sizes and cluster endpoints. The prod values currently in effect are listed below.

settings of fafog-haduf:
ZORIX_PIN=4648
ZORIX_METRICS_HOST=metrics.zorix.paliqsys.corp
ZORIX_LOG_LEVEL=info
ZORIX_TENANT=druix